Carl Hansen CH108 Coffee Table 170x70cm

Carl Hansen CH108 Coffee Table 170x70cm

Manufacturer: Carl Hansen

Designer: Hans Wegner

The CH108 glass and steel coffee table is part of Hans J. Wegner’s elegant CH100 series. The brushed flat steel frame has a beautiful, smooth surface which is clearly visible through the sturdy rectangular glass top. The Wegner coffee table is also available in a smaller square version; CH106.

The sturdy, square glass tabletop rests on a frame consisting of two trestles in bent flat steel, which are connected via two transverse steel rails. The rails also function as a support for the top, whose polished glass makes the frame’s structure fully visible. With the frames soft bends and the rounded corners of the glass, the design looks soft and harmonious despite its solid materials.

The CH108 coffee table is a fine example of Hans J. Wegner’s viewpoint about good design which aims at finding a balance between the simple and the characteristic. The table also shows that Wegner was not timid about throwing himself into designs based on materials other than wood. 

In addition to the rectangular shaped CH108, Wegner designed a squared version of the table, CH106. Both tables are included in the CH100 series together with the CH101 lounge chair and the three sofas, CH102, CH103 and CH104.
